Marvel kicked off an insanely busy Saturday at Comic-Con 2007 with the Ultimate Universe panel. Big room, big crowd, big reveals.

The Marvel entourage entered the room at about 10:45, with Brian Michael Bendis, Jim McCann, Jeph Loeb, David Finch and a host of younger folks. Families! Gotta love 'em.

Everybody clocked in at about 10:50 on stage to thunderous applause. Joe Quesada isn't here yet, though.

First up on the to-talk list is Ultimate Spider-Man's "Death of a Goblin." Yes, a Goblin dies. But which one? Lots of Norman Osborn talk! Kitty Pryde post-X-Men has a new costume! That ain't Hellcat! Spidey and Kitty join S.H.I.E.L.D. This is a biiiig arc!

ULTIMATE POWER!!! And appropriately enough, Joe Quesada arrived! Coincidence? I think not!

Jeph Loeb

Jeph's talking about ULTIMATE POWER. Look for the series to have a "wow finish." Seriously. It's going to be ginormous and lead right into a megaton of stuff. It'll really change both the Ultimate and Supreme Power universes.

Now ULTIMATE X-MEN! Sentinels!

ULTIMATES 3!!! December 2007! Believe it. It's gorgeous. The villain cover wowed the whole crowd, since everyone here has seen the hero cover in giant-form at the Marvel booth.
Did we say December? It kicks off in December.

Announcement (kinda)! ULTIMATE ORIGINS by Brian Michael Bendis and Butch Guice, with covers by Simone Bianchi. Aw, Jeph likened Simone's accent to that of Super Mario Brothers. But he says it with love. Well, I guess showing some beautiful Bianchi art for the first time counts for some announcey goodness.

Brian Michael Bendis

Jeph and Brian are relaying the hows and whys of the formation of the Ultimate Universe. From the start before ULTIMATE SPIDER-MAN to how things are ramping back up. ULTIMATE POWER 7-9, ULTIMATE ORIGINS and then…

Oh wait, Butch Guice has signed exclusive with Marvel. YEAH! First art from ORIGINS! I thought it was ORIGIN, not plural. Hm.

Anyway, from ULTIMATE POWER to ORIGINS to ULTIMATES 3.

ULTIMATUM! Loeb and Finch! From ULTIMATE FF to ULTIMATE X-MEN. Back and forth. Big, big, big stuff! "Things will change forever," says Loeb. Deaths will stick, changes can be made, teams can disband and never come back together.

Q: ULTIMATE ORIGINS, are they one-shots or story arcs?

A:
It's a six issue mini-series and self-contained, and deals with the intertwined characters and how they are all connected. Loeb says it's an extremely complicated story of how things happened, not just a series of events. You don't have to know the Ultimate Universe for the last five years to understand it. It's a good jumping on point. Bendis says it takes place in the past and present simultaneously and jumps back and forth.
